At the end of autumn, just before the beginning of winter, the team of the project "Reintroduction of the Saker falcon in Bulgaria" conducted the yearly health check ups of the birds inhabiting the aviaries of the Rescue Center.

Veterinary medicine students from Trakia University, interns at the Center, also participated in the prevention.

The traditional health check ups of the saker falcons, are held every fall under the direction of the Center's veterinarians,and they include an examination and deworming for internal and external parasites. Special attention is paid to the plumage of the birds, as well as their beaks and claws. And, where necessary, the latter are trimmed and/or filed.

During the examinations, the aviaries, the home of the birds, were also inspected. In addition to their cleaning and disinfection, some of the facilities were repaired.

Thus, the saker falcons at the Rescue Center of Green Balkans will welcome this winter in good health and clean, repaired homes.

The 'Reintroduction of the Saker Falcon in Bulgaria' project is funded by Mohamed Bin Zayed Raptor Conservation Fund and Armeec JSC
